Question
Using step$-$deviation method, calculate the mean marks of the following distribution
Class Interval $50 - 55$ $55 - 60$ $60 - 65$ $65 - 70$ $70 - 75$ $75 - 80$ $80 - 85$ $85 - 90$
Frequency $5$ $20$ $10$ $10$ $9$ $6$ $12$ $8$

Answer

Image
$\therefore \text { Mean } X = A +\frac{\sum f \cdot u}{\sum f} \times i .[ i =\text { length of C.I. }]$
$=67.5+\frac{24}{80} \times 5$
$=67.5+1.5$
$=69 .$
